Pre-18th Century Power Dynamics
- Aristocrats and monarchs controlled economic and social power before the 18th century.
Emergence of New Ideas
- After the French Revolution, many parts of the world began discussing new ideas such as liberty, equality, and democracy.
Post-French Revolution Possibilities
- The French Revolution made it possible for the dramatic change of overthrowing monarchies and creating new nation-states.
The French Revolution's Impact on India
- Raja Rammohan Roy talked about the significance of the French Revolution in India, highlighting its importance in spreading modern ideas.
Debates in India
- Many others in India debated about the applicability of these modern ideas in their own society, sparking discussions about social and political reforms.
